js怎么引用圆周率符号

js怎么引用圆周率符号

在JavaScript中引用圆周率符号(π)的方法有多种,主要包括Math.PI、Unicode字符、以及自定义变量。 对于大多数情况下,使用Math.PI是最方便和最常见的方式。以下是详细描述及具体示例:

一、使用Math.PI

JavaScript 提供了内置的 Math 对象,其中包含了表示圆周率的常量 Math.PI。 这是一种标准且最常用的方法。

示例代码:

console.log(Math.PI); // 输出: 3.141592653589793

具体应用场景:

假设我们需要计算圆的周长和面积。我们可以使用 Math.PI 轻松完成这些计算。

function calculateCircleProperties(radius) {

const circumference = 2 * Math.PI * radius;

const area = Math.PI * radius * radius;

return {

circumference: circumference,

area: area

};

}

const radius = 5;

const properties = calculateCircleProperties(radius);

console.log(`圆的周长: ${properties.circumference}`);

console.log(`圆的面积: ${properties.area}`);

二、使用Unicode字符

另一种方法是使用 Unicode 字符来表示 π。这种方法更适合在需要显示圆周率符号的场景中使用。

示例代码:

const piSymbol = 'u03C0';

console.log(piSymbol); // 输出: π

具体应用场景:

假设我们有一个数学公式展示的页面,需要动态生成包含 π 符号的内容。

const radius = 5;

const piSymbol = 'u03C0';

const formula = `C = 2${piSymbol}r = 2${piSymbol}${radius}`;

console.log(formula); // 输出: C = 2πr = 2π5

三、自定义变量

你也可以通过自定义变量来引用圆周率符号。这种方法灵活性高,但需注意保持代码的一致性和可读性。

示例代码:

const PI = 3.141592653589793;

console.log(PI); // 输出: 3.141592653589793

具体应用场景:

如果你在项目中频繁使用圆周率,可以定义一个常量来提高代码的可读性。

const PI = 3.141592653589793;

function calculateCircleProperties(radius) {

const circumference = 2 * PI * radius;

const area = PI * radius * radius;

return {

circumference: circumference,

area: area

};

}

const radius = 5;

const properties = calculateCircleProperties(radius);

console.log(`圆的周长: ${properties.circumference}`);

console.log(`圆的面积: ${properties.area}`);

四、使用模板字符串

在一些复杂的场景中,模板字符串可以帮助我们更直观地展示公式和结果。

示例代码:

const radius = 5;

const formula = `C = 2πr = 2${Math.PI}${radius}`;

console.log(formula); // 输出: C = 2πr = 2 3.141592653589793 5

具体应用场景:

在 Web 应用开发中,经常需要动态生成带有数学公式的内容。使用模板字符串可以使代码更简洁和易读。

const radius = 5;

const circumference = `C = 2πr = 2${Math.PI}${radius}`;

const area = `A = πr² = ${Math.PI}${radius}²`;

console.log(circumference); // 输出: C = 2πr = 2 3.141592653589793 5

console.log(area); // 输出: A = πr² = 3.141592653589793 5²

五、结合项目管理系统

在实际的项目开发中,使用项目管理系统可以帮助我们更好地组织和管理代码。这里推荐 研发项目管理系统PingCode通用项目协作软件Worktile,它们可以帮助开发团队更有效地协作和管理代码。

示例代码:

// 使用研发项目管理系统PingCode进行项目管理

const PI = Math.PI;

function calculateCircleProperties(radius) {

const circumference = 2 * PI * radius;

const area = PI * radius * radius;

return {

circumference: circumference,

area: area

};

}

// 在项目管理系统中记录和管理代码

const radius = 5;

const properties = calculateCircleProperties(radius);

console.log(`圆的周长: ${properties.circumference}`);

console.log(`圆的面积: ${properties.area}`);

具体应用场景:

在使用项目管理系统时,可以将代码片段、计算结果和相关文档一起管理,方便团队成员查看和协作。

结论

在JavaScript中引用圆周率符号的方法主要包括:Math.PI、Unicode字符、自定义变量模板字符串。每种方法都有其独特的应用场景和优势。无论你选择哪种方法,都可以结合项目管理系统如 PingCodeWorktile,来提高开发效率和代码管理的规范性。

相关问答FAQs:

Q: 如何在JavaScript中引用圆周率符号?

A: JavaScript中没有内置的圆周率符号,但可以通过一些方法来实现引用圆周率的效果。

Q: 怎样用JavaScript表示圆周率?

A: 在JavaScript中,可以使用Math对象中的PI属性来表示圆周率。例如,可以使用Math.PI来获取圆周率的值。

Q: 圆周率在JavaScript中的精度是多少?

A: 在JavaScript中,Math.PI的精度约为15位。这意味着Math.PI的值是近似的,而不是完全准确的圆周率值。如果需要更高精度的圆周率值,可以使用第三方库或自定义函数来计算。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3860386

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部